Use docker to run helper servers in e2e
Reliably cleaning up leftover things like `nc` processes is surprisingly difficult in pure shell. e2e passes on the master branch now.

# A simple server for tests
|
||||
|
||||
DO NOT USE THIS FOR ANYTHING BUT TESTING!!!
|
||||
|
||||
## How to use it
|
||||
|
||||
Build yourself a test image. We use example.com so you can't accidentally push
|
||||
it.
|
||||
|
||||
```
|
||||
$ docker build -t example.com/test/test-ncvsr .
|
||||
...lots of output...
|
||||
Successfully tagged example.com/test/test-ncsvr:latest
|
||||
```
|
||||
|
||||
Run it.
|
||||
|
||||
```
|
||||
$ docker run -d example.com/test/test-ncsvr 9376 "echo hello"
|
||||
6d05b4111b03c66907031e3cd7587763f0e4fab6c50fac33c4a8284732b448ae
|
||||
```
|
||||
|
||||
Find your IP.
|
||||
|
||||
```
|
||||
$ docker inspect 6d05b4111b03c66907031e3cd7587763f0e4fab6c50fac33c4a8284732b448ae | jq -r .[0].NetworkSettings.IPAddress
|
||||
192.168.1.2
|
||||
```
|
||||
|
||||
Connect to it.
|
||||
|
||||
```
|
||||
$ echo "" | nc 192.168.9.2 9376
|
||||
hello
|
||||
```
|
||||
|
||||
If you want to know how many times it was accessed, mount a file on
|
||||
/var/log/hits. This will log one line per hit.
